PIC单片机(Peripheral Interface Controller)是一种用来开发和控制外围设备的集成电路(IC)。一种具有分散作用(多任务)功能的CPU。与人类相比,大脑就是CPU,PIC 共享的部分相当于人的神经系统。
class="markdown_views prism-atelier-sulphurpool-light"> 说明:文章来源 EDN电子技术设计:嵌入式程序开发需要知道的存储器知识 MCU 中常使用的存储器类型有:FLASH、RAM、ROM(包括EEPROM) 在软件角度来看,程序和数...
随着硬件系统的模块化发展,很多电子产品都做出模块并采用串口进行数据通信。例如:GPRS模块、GPS模块、语音模块、热敏微型打印机、串口摄像头等等。在与这些模块进行数据通信都离不开串口,而对于串口的操作,由于串口本身没有标准...
硬件:STC89C52RC 开发工具:Keil uVision4 对于刚接触单片机的同学来说可能会对定时器/计数器的应用很蒙圈,特别是初值的计算和各种定时方式的选择。下面希望能给你带来一个清晰的思路。 定时器:一般用于软件计时,给定时器设...
单片机之间、单片机与计算机之间交换信息有串行通信和并行通信两种方式。并行通信的特点是传送控制简单、速度快、但随着通信距离的增加,并行通信的线路成本远远高于串行通信,串行通信已成为集散控制、多机系统和现代测控系统...
Tensorflow启动图需要首先建立一个会话,本文对比三种启动图的方法,如下: sess = tf.Session():启动图需要显示指明使用哪个图,即sess.run(),或者run(session=sess) with tf.Session() as sess:在with的代码块内,使用sess作...
引进 webuploader.min.js与webuploader.css与upload.js 点击下载(upload.js) 此js包含传向后端接收图片的地址 后端接收前台上传的图片处理方法 上传并压缩图片 1、页面部分。 选择图片: ...
1.3 Hello JavaScript 看完了JavaScript神奇之处的演示,你是否已经跃跃欲试了呢。那么就跟随本章下面的例子来窥探一下JavaScript究竟都可以干什么吧。 1.3.1 网页变脸 下面是一个很简单的例子,只有几行代码,并且不需要建立什么...
C源程序中直接嵌入汇编指令: asm(clrwdt); 双引号中可以编写任何一条PIC的标准汇编指令 如果写一段连续的汇编指令:使用 #asm …… …… …… #endasm
指CPU处理的数据的宽度,参与运算的寄存器的数据长度? 如果总线宽度与CPU一次处理的数据宽度相同,则这个宽度就是所说的单片机位数。 如果总线宽度与CPU一次处理的数据宽度不同: 1)总线宽度小于CPU一次处理的数据宽度,则以CPU的数据宽...
函数使用了long变量,比较占RAM,单片机要是空间紧张就别用了,会把mcu算糊涂的。/******* timestamp时间戳函数 开始**********/#define SECOND_OF_DAY 86400 //一天多少秒idata uchar DayOfMon[]={31,28,31,30,31,30,31,31,30,31,3...
// // main.c // Test // char *my_strcat(char *str1, char *str2) { char *pt = str1; while(*str1!='
https://blog.csdn.net/fengshuiyue/article/details/79150724 单片机入门学习十三 STM32单片机学习十 通用定时器 里面写的挺不错,图文并茂,大家可以去参阅。
公共函数意思就完全公开的函数,在平台的任意一个角落都可以调用,智能窗体构建时、表单流程的扩展代码中、主页插件配置时、以及主窗体事件中都是可以调用的,但是目前不能调用这些公共函数的只有一个地方,那就是在报表设计器里面设计报...
1,电平:数字电路中只有两种电平,高电平和低电平,对应的是计算机中的二进制原理。 2,晶振电路:决定单片机运行的节奏,即频率。 3,复位电路:重置开发板。 4,机器周期:一个机器周期包含12个时钟周期,在一个机器周期内,c...
在计机领域,堆栈是一个不容忽视的概念,我们编写的C语言程序基本上都要用到。但对于很多的初学着来说,堆栈是一个很模糊的概念。堆栈:一种数据结构、一个在程序运行时用于存放的地方,这可能是很多初学者的认识,因为我曾经就是这么想的和...